How to Buy Bitcoin Anonymously using Fiat [2022] | by Arpit Agarwal | The Capital | Nov, 2022

Despite the plethora of cryptocurrency exchanges available in the market today, the percentage of the ones that are still anonymous and private is, unfortunately, shrinking.

With stringent rules and government interventions, almost all exchanges that once allowed anonymity to their users have succumbed to KYC norms, collecting ID and personal documents to allow access to their services, especially when fiat currency is involved in the trade.

Few popular exchanges still allow non-KYC users to trade on their platform but with heavy restrictions on the limit of trades.

Thankfully, there are still a few services available that are decentralized, and allow users to trade privately without the need for KYC or any other ID verification.

If you wish to buy or sell bitcoin anonymously, then these exchanges are some of the best options in the market right now.

Bisq is a Decentralised Autonomous Organisation that is run entirely by the community. It is, in fact, one of the first DAO exchanges to offer a P2P marketplace for cryptocurrencies and fiat.

It is 100% open source and one of the few organizations to fully embrace the principle on which bitcoin and cryptocurrency were built, decentralization, transparency, and anonymity.

To use the service, you will need to download the application and install it on your computer. The platform is easy to use and perfect for beginners. For enhanced privacy, it uses the Tor network to connect to the blockchain.

While Bisq is open to the global community, most offers are limited to USD and Euro fiat pairs.

Fees:

  • BTC: 1% (0.12% — maker and 0.88% — taker).
  • BSQ: 0.5% (0.06% — maker and 0.44% — taker).

Pros:

  • 100% Open Source
  • Easy to Use
  • Secure
  • Multiple currency support: BTC, BSQ, ETH, XMR, LTC, etc.

Cons:

  • Rather low liquidity with most fiat offers limited to USD and Euro
  • Not for experienced traders

HodlHodl is a non-custodial P2P bitcoin exchange that directly connects users globally who wish to buy/sell bitcoin.

HodlHodl does not hold your funds and uses multi-sig escrow to lock the funds reducing the chances of scams and also reducing trade time. The platform also incorporates a reputation system where the users are reviewed for their trades.

The platform deals mainly with BTC, and no other cryptocurrency is supported.

In addition to BTC trades, HodlHodl also offers lending, which allows you to lend/borrow BTC from users directly at the desired rate.

Fees: 0.6% per trade (0.3% maker — 0.3% taker)

Pros:

  • Open Source
  • Easy to Use
  • Secure

Cons:

  • Only supports BTC
  • Rather low liquidity with most fiat offers limited to USD, Euro, and Pound

A P2P non-custodial crypto marketplace, LocalCryptos connects crypto buyers and sellers from around the globe.

A completely private and anonymous platform, LocalCryptos just needs an email address to get started. It also provides login options using external wallets such as MetaMask for a smoother experience.

It features a simple yet intuitive platform that makes trading that much simpler.

In terms of security, it incorporates, a reputation system, escrow accounts, 2FA, end-to-end encryption, and dispute resolution.

In addition to Bitcoin, the platform supports, ETH, LTC, DASH, and BCH.

Fees: 1% per trade (0.25% maker — 0.75% taker)

Pros:

  • Intuitive & modern platform
  • Secure

Cons:

  • Not open source
  • Some sellers may ask for KYC — avoid them

AgoraDesk is a P2P marketplace for Bitcoin and Monero that connects global users directly with each other.

It is a completely private platform where you don’t even need an email address to get started.

It is an easy-to-use platform where users can search for offers in their desired currency and start a trade with any of the available options.

AgoraDesk uses Tor for enhanced security and even has a no JavaScript version of the platform.

Fees: 1% fee for every completed trade from users who create the advertisement

Pros:

  • Private
  • Secure
  • No fee for Takers

Cons:

  • Only supports BTC and XMR

RoboSats, is a Tor-only non-custodial bitcoin exchange that embraces some of the best privacy standards for its users.

The platform generates a cool unique single-use avatar with a unique token every time you enter the platform and communicate with other users.

Once inside the platform, you can look at the available offers and choose the one you want to trade with. RoboSats uses Lightning bond invoices and escrow to prevent any fraudulent activity.

Fees: 0.2% (Maker — 0.025% and Taker — 0.175%)

Pros:

  • Super Private and Anonymous
  • Secure
  • Low Fees

Cons:

  • Low liquidity — only support for USD and Euro
  • Need lightening Network
  • Small Transaction amounts

One-of-kind Bitcoin Exchange that operates fully on Telegram using Bots, Bitcoin Voucher Bots allows users to buy BTC with Euro. Since the entire process takes place over Telegram, no information is collected about the users, including cookies or IP addresses.

Transacting in BitcoinVoucherBot is as easy as texting, and can entire process is managed by bots.

BitcoinVoucher Bot can be used to purchase Vouchers that you can redeem in Bitcoin instantly (On-chain, Lightning, Liquid), Coin Swaps, EUR/BTC Swaps, and Accumulation plans.

You can buy/sell BTC vouchers for Euro using SEPA bank transfer. The limit is 900/Euro per day for non-KYC users.

Fees: 2.5% for direct BTC/Euro Swap

Pros:

  • Private
  • Easy to Use
  • Minimal Fee

Cons:

  • The only Fiat currency supported is Euro
  • Limited amount per transaction
  • High Fees

As the option to buy bitcoin anonymously is getting limited with time, rest assured as there are and always will be services that allow for decentralized and anonymous trading.

But unlike traditional exchanges, which operate using a liquidity pool, P2P exchanges directly connect buyers and sellers, and it does come with some inherent security risks in the form of scams or fraudulent users. So,

  • It is always prudent to execute a trade with a reputed seller with good reviews,
  • Never share your personal details with anyone except the absolutely necessary details required to receive/send the payments.

Also, most anonymous decentralized exchanges available today deal with mainly USD and Euro, which may be an issue for users who wish to transact in any other fiat currency. So, before choosing a platform, do make sure that there are offers for your fiat currency.
